This guide will provide you with the necessary steps to properly wash your Skechers shoes.To clean your Skechers shoes, start by removing any dirt or debris with a soft brush. Then, dampen a cloth or sponge with warm water and mild dish soap. Gently scrub both the outside and inside of the shoes with the cloth or sponge. Once you’ve removed all of the dirt, rinse the shoes off with fresh water. To dry them, stuff them with newspaper and allow them to air dry at room temperature.

Washing Shoes in the Washing Machine
Washing shoes in a washing machine can be a great way to keep them clean and fresh. It is an easy and convenient way to keep your shoes looking their best. However, there are a few things you should know before you put your shoes in the wash.
First, it is important to check the care label on your shoes before putting them in the washing machine. Different materials require different washing instructions, so make sure to follow the manufacturer’s guidelines for best results. For leather or suede shoes, hand-washing with a mild detergent is typically recommended.
If the care label allows, you can put your shoes in the washing machine using a mild detergent on a gentle cycle. To reduce wear and tear on your shoes, use a gentle cycle with cold water and no spin cycle. Additionally, it’s best to place your shoes in mesh bags before putting them in the washer to keep them from getting damaged or tangled with other items.
Once the cycle has finished, remove your shoes from the machine and allow them to air dry away from direct sunlight or heat sources. Do not put leather or suede shoes in the dryer as this can cause them to shrink or crack. For fabric or canvas sneakers, you can tumble dry on low heat if necessary.

Freshening Up the Shoes with Baking Soda
Baking soda is a great way to freshen up your shoes. Not only does it absorb odors and keep them away, but it also helps keep your shoes looking like new. It’s easy and inexpensive to use baking soda on your shoes, so you can make them look and smell great without spending a lot of money. Here’s how to use baking soda to freshen up your shoes:
The first step is to remove any dirt or debris from the surface of the shoe. This will help the baking soda do its job more effectively and also make the shoe look cleaner. You can use a soft brush or cloth to get rid of any dirt or grime.
Once you’ve removed any debris, sprinkle some baking soda over the entire surface of the shoe. Make sure it covers all areas, including the tongue and laces. Let it sit for at least an hour so that it can absorb any odors.
After an hour has passed, remove the baking soda with a vacuum or brush. Once it’s been removed, you’ll be left with a clean-smelling pair of shoes! If you want to keep them smelling fresh for longer, you can repeat this process every few weeks.
